A gigantic Japanese grocery store complete with a semi-outdoor market hall will open in Pleasant Hill next year, the city officials recently announced.

Osaka Marketplace in Pleasant Hill will take over the 42,000-square-foot space formerly occupied by Orchard Supply Hardware. The expected opening date is November 2026 — about a year after Osaka opens its Foster City location, which is set to debut this month.

“Osaka Marketplace will bring the flavors of Japan to Pleasant Hill,” general manager Kazuhiro Takeda said in a press release put out by the city. The release stated, “The grocery store will offer an extensive selection of authentic Japanese groceries, fresh produce, seafood, ready-to-eat meals and hard-to-find imported foods and goods – all under one roof.”
